Output f081c95c93858021841c0b566f5ce2005439b9feb4388c51d38c4cdd8d6438c0:0

value
6938310526954
script pubkey
OP_0 OP_PUSHBYTES_20 cf7037121a8ab90ad3c93b541148234a05d40558
address
tb1qeacrwys632us457f8d2pzjprfgzagp2cjpsg3s
transaction
f081c95c93858021841c0b566f5ce2005439b9feb4388c51d38c4cdd8d6438c0
confirmations
179236
spent
true